Are valence electrons inner or outer?
Valence electrons are the electrons in the outermost shell, or energy level, of an atom. For example, oxygen has six valence electrons, two in the 2s subshell and four in the 2p subshell.
What are outer and inner electrons?
The outermost occupied shell in an atom is its valence shell. Electrons found in shells with smaller principal quantum numbers are called inner shell electrons.
What is the difference between outer electrons and valence electrons?
The outermost orbital shell of an atom is called its valence shell, and the electrons in the valence shell are valence electrons. While inner electrons (those not in the valence shell) typically don’t participate in chemical bonding and reactions, valence electrons can be gained, lost, or shared to form chemical bonds.
What is the easiest way to find valence electrons?
For neutral atoms, the number of valence electrons is equal to the atom’s main group number. The main group number for an element can be found from its column on the periodic table. For example, carbon is in group 4 and has 4 valence electrons. Oxygen is in group 6 and has 6 valence electrons.
How many inner outer and valence electrons are in oxygen?
Oxygen has 8 electrons — 2 in the first shell, and 6 in the second shell (so six valence electrons). Fluorine has 9 electrons — 2 in the first shell, and 7 in the second shell (so seven valence electrons). Neon has 10 electrons — 2 in the first shell, and 8 in the second shell (so eight valence electrons).

Do d orbitals count as valence electrons?
Usually only the electrons in the highest energy level are counted as being valence, but for transition metals, the d-orbital electrons after the previous noble gas configuration count too. For example, for Fe which has an electron configuration of [Ar]3d64s2, it has 8 valence electrons.
What are inner electrons called?
core electrons
Electrons in the outermost shell are called valence electrons. It is the valence electrons determine an atom’s chemical properties. Electrons in the inner shells are inner electrons or core electrons.
What are outer electrons called?
valence shell
The number of electrons in the outermost shell of a particular atom determines its reactivity, or tendency to form chemical bonds with other atoms. This outermost shell is known as the valence shell, and the electrons found in it are called valence electrons.
